Question: With reference to Example 20, Chapter 7, construct a 95% confidence interval for the true standard deviation of the lead content. Data From Example 20

EXAMPLE 20 At test of a normal population mean Scientists need to be able to detect small amounts of contaminants in the environ- ment. As a check on current capabilities, measurements of lead content(g/L) are taken from twelve water specimens spiked with a known concentration. (courtesy of Paul Berthouex). 2.4 2.9 2.7 2.6 2.9 2.0 2.8 2.2 2.4 2.4 2.0 2.5 Test the null hypothesis = at the 0.025 level of significance. 2.25 against the alternative hypothesis > 2.25 There are no outliers or other indications of non-normality. As a preliminary step we calculate x = 2.483 and s = 0.3129.
